Why does the city and/or utility trim trees?

Tree limbs and power lines are not a good combination – especially in severe weather. Trees are a common cause of service interruption and outages. A damaging storm can disrupt power for extended periods.  In addition, tree limbs and branches that extend into power lines pose a significant risk to public safety even with mild weather.
